Mack And Mabel
The great Hollywood comic director, Mack Sennett, reminisces about his career from the sound stage of the studios he once ran. In a series of flashbacks, Sennett relates the glory days of the Keystone Studios, when he discovered Mabel Normand, star of dozens of his early "two-reelers", through his invention of the Bathing Beauties and Keystone Cops to Mabel's death from a heroin overdose. An incredible musical with songs such as "I Won't Send Roses", "Big Time" and "Time Heals Everything" - this show brings the movies and Hollywood to the stage in all its glory...walk up the red carpet to see.
